internall/poll: remove bufs field from Windows' poll.operation
The bufs field is used to avoid allocating it every time it is needed. We can do better by using a sync.Pool to reuse allocations across operations and FDs instead of the field. A side benefit is that FD is now 16 bytes smaller and operation more stateless.
